Subject: [PATCH v8 4/8] bpftool: Ensure task comm is always NUL-terminated

Let's explicitly ensure the destination string is NUL-terminated. This way,
it won't be affected by changes to the source string.

Signed-off-by: Yafang Shao <laoar.shao@gmail.com>
Reviewed-by: Quentin Monnet <qmo@kernel.org>
---
 tools/bpf/bpftool/pids.c | 2 ++
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+)

diff --git a/tools/bpf/bpftool/pids.c b/tools/bpf/bpftool/pids.c
index 9b898571b49e..23f488cf1740 100644
--- a/tools/bpf/bpftool/pids.c
+++ b/tools/bpf/bpftool/pids.c
@@ -54,6 +54,7 @@ static void add_ref(struct hashmap *map, struct pid_iter_entry *e)
 		ref = &refs->refs[refs->ref_cnt];
 		ref->pid = e->pid;
 		memcpy(ref->comm, e->comm, sizeof(ref->comm));
+		ref->comm[sizeof(ref->comm) - 1] = '\0';
 		refs->ref_cnt++;
 
 		return;
@@ -77,6 +78,7 @@ static void add_ref(struct hashmap *map, struct pid_iter_entry *e)
 	ref = &refs->refs[0];
 	ref->pid = e->pid;
 	memcpy(ref->comm, e->comm, sizeof(ref->comm));
+	ref->comm[sizeof(ref->comm) - 1] = '\0';
 	refs->ref_cnt = 1;
 	refs->has_bpf_cookie = e->has_bpf_cookie;
 	refs->bpf_cookie = e->bpf_cookie;
